material inventory management software is a computer-based system that helps businesses keep track of their inventory levels, monitor stock movements, and forecast future inventory needs. This software comes with a wide range of features and capabilities that can help businesses of all sizes effectively manage their materials inventory.
One of the key benefits of using material inventory management software is the ability to accurately track inventory levels in real-time. This can help businesses avoid stockouts and overstock situations, which can lead to lost sales and unnecessary costs. By having up-to-date information on inventory levels, businesses can make better decisions about when to reorder materials, how much to order, and where to store them.
Another important feature of material inventory management software is the ability to monitor stock movements throughout the supply chain. This can help businesses identify bottlenecks, inefficiencies, and areas for improvement in their material flow processes. By tracking stock movements from suppliers to warehouses to production facilities to customers, businesses can better optimize their supply chain and reduce costs.
Forecasting future inventory needs is another key feature of many material inventory management software programs. By analyzing historical data, current inventory levels, and future demand projections, businesses can accurately predict their future inventory needs and plan accordingly. This can help businesses avoid stockouts, reduce excess inventory, and improve overall operational efficiency.
In addition to these core features, many material inventory management software programs come with a range of additional capabilities to help businesses streamline their operations. These may include barcode scanning, serial number tracking, lot tracking, expiry date tracking, automated reorder point calculations, and integration with other business systems such as accounting and purchasing.
